Research has continually indicated that teachers face systemic challenges to their assessment practices, including using assessment to support diverse learners and navigating technology. This study examined factors shaping teachers’ perceived frequency and significance of six core assessment challenges as identified in previous research. Data were collected from 368 teachers via an online survey. We identified significant correlations between the perceived frequency and significance of each assessment challenge and demographics, teachers’ approaches to assessment, assessment-related emotions, and associations between teachers’ approaches to assessment and assessment-related emotions. Teachers who endorsed student-centric approaches to assessment were more likely to report positive assessment emotions and perceive assessment challenges as more frequent and significant than those endorsing teacher-centric approaches.
